Keywords vs. copying |
Notes are recorded as keywords and phrases. |
Notes are primarily recorded as keywords and phrases. |
Notes are primarily copied from the source. Some evidence of keywords and phrases. |
Notes are copied directly from the source. |
| Relevance | Notes relate to the topic. | Notes primarily relate to the topic. | Some notes relate to the topic, but many don't. | Notes are not related to the topic. |
Organization |
All notes are organized, bulleted, and neat.
Has heading, topic/subtopics listed, and search terms are listed. |
Most notes are organized, bulleted, and neat.
Heading, topic, and search terms are mainly complete. |
Some evidence that notes are organized, bulleted, and neat.
Heading, topic, and search terms are incomplete. |
No evidence of notes that are organized, bulleted, and neat.
No heading, topic, or search terms listed. |
Citations |
All notes refer to their source. |
Notes primarily refer to their source. |
Some evidence that notes refer to their source. |
No evidence that notes refer to their source. |
